The essays and poems in this small book are the result of rummaging through the antique gemstones of my memory and the pleasure of putting words on paper. They are about people and events that, for reasons obscure, stand out over what has now been many years of varied experience. The entries are a kaleidoscope of other times and places, a fragmented sort-of-memoir strung together by retained images, the joy of making one's way in the world, the comfort of family, friends, and collegial relationships. The underlying theme throughout is wonder at the way the world works.
